July 7, 201213 yr I think SBuilderX is still the best. There is another app that uses Google Earth kml data but I didn't find it that useful for me, so haven't looked at it in years. In many cases you can get good advice on SBuilder here, but also on fsdeveloper.com. One thing on that other site, one of the mods (user "Rhumbaflappy") posts updates to the dll for downloading Google Map data which conforms to the latest Google map api. If you have access to GIS vector data you can put it into shapefile format which SBuilder can import. For raster data, also GeoTiff is straightforward to use with the Ms sdk scenery tools. In some cases you can use SBuilderX to create raster data and import inlto your GIS for further work if you find SBuilderX limiting. SBuilderX has an extrusion bridge tool that is good if you want this type of scenery. It does object placement (using simconnect to get airplane location from FSX so you can slew in FSX to get locations if you don't want to use a background photo for placement). It also has a generic building creation tool for some quick buildings. Or try Sketchup and ModelConverterX also from fsdeveloper.com to custom create objects. (Arno keeps adding stuff into MCX - it's very useful even just to look at existing models.) scott s. .
